5-nitro-2-furaldehyde semicarbazone 5-nitro-2-furaldehyde semicarbazone

structural formula
| business number | 01aq |
|---|---|
| molecular formula | c6h6n4o4 |
| molecular weight | 198.14 |
| label |
nitrofurazone, furacin, nfz, nitrofurazone |
numbering system
cas number:59-87-0
mdl number:mfcd00003225
einecs number:200-443-1
rtecs number:lt7700000
brn number:86403
pubchem number:24886543
physical property data
1. characteristics: yellow crystalline powder.

synthesis method
prepared from furfural through nitration, esterification and hydrolysis5-nitrofurfural, and then condensed with amino hydrochloride to obtain nitrofurazone.
purpose
this product is a nitrofuran antibacterial drug. this class of drugs also includes furazolidone and nitrofurantoin. nitrofuracillin is highly toxic when taken orally and is used for local or surface disinfection in surgery.
